Anyway, to make a long story short, I’m considering moving to a new host, as my current one, Fateback isn’t what it used to be. It was great when I initially signed up, but now I’m getting tired of it. I mean, I’ve mentioned before to people that ads bother me, but their initial design (a little bar at the top of the screen) was relatively subtle. Now they added some more banners and it’s not so subtle. Add to that a 200 KB file size limit, which was very annoying when I wanted to upload images, and an annoying tendency to reroute broken Fateback links to an ad page than a simple 404 error (and heaven knows if that ad page doesn’t have something worse lurking in the code), and I’m thinking maybe I should try something new.

I was wondering if any of you had any free hosts you would recommend – I’m not using it for anything fancy, just your basic HTML pages and images, so I’m not worried about what kind of scripts it can run and all that stuff -- if it's got FTP, I'm good. Any switching of hosts would be a while away anyway, but I’d rather get a head start on searching. I might not switch at all if I don’t find something I like.

For what it’s worth, my current host offers 60 MB of space (which, at one point, I thought I had gone over) and is generally good about uptime (there was a period of time a few years back where it was frequently down, but the problem rarely cropped up besides that), so if there are any hosts out there with at least those two qualities I’d be happy. Ideally the file-size limit would be a little larger too, but I can work with 200 KB. ;P
